Flood Damage Restoration
Flood damage restoration is a process that helps clean up and fix your home after it gets wet. The first step is to remove the water. This may involve using pumps and vacuums to suck up all the water. The quicker this is done, the better, because water can cause more damage if it stays in your home.
After the water is removed, the next step is drying everything out. Restoration experts use large fans and dehumidifiers to make sure the air is dry. This helps prevent mold from growing. Mold can be very dangerous, so it's important to dry your home as fast as possible!
Once everything is dry, it's time to check for damage. Experts will look for things like stains on walls, warped wood, and damaged carpets. If they find anything that needs to be fixed, they will make a plan to repair it. Sometimes, parts of the walls or floors may need to be replaced.
Another important part of flood restoration is cleaning. Everything that got wet needs to be cleaned properly. This can include washing carpets, cleaning surfaces, and making sure everything is safe and healthy again. The final step is to check if everything is back to normal.
